The Nanny Diaries delves into the life of Annie Braddock, a recent college grad who mistakenly lands a job as a nanny for the wealthy and dysfunctional X family in Manhattan's Upper East Side. Tasked with the care of their neglected young son, Annie endures the absurd demands of Mrs. X and the indifference of Mr. X, all while managing her own personal growth and identity. In a narrative rich with humor and social commentary, the story peels back the layers of high society's childcare practices to reveal the complex realities of modern parenting and employment.
